Hi,

is there a way to uninstall ROM Control?
By clean flash . There is not an uninstaller for it .
And by installing it change SystemUi , changing the modified apk with the default ones.
Or make this modify so you don't need to flash it again , but you need to download the rom again anyway :
In /system/priv-app you have this folders to replace SecSettings and SystemUI you can take them from original rom , and uninstall RomControl after that , reboot .

The most simple way is to clean flash the rom, make a backup of your data if you don't want to lose it.

How to get rid of the TRoaming and kT Service Provider in settings menu.
Open any root explorer (MixPlorer or what you actually prefer), go to so system/omc/INS there will be another "INS" folder, copy that to your Internal Storage / SD card, go to /system/omc delete "INS" folder and copy the "INS" folder you copied to your Internal Storage / SD card in place of that.

Might sound complicated but it's easy. I will also fix that in the next update, mate.
